Multicenter StudyELIMINATE: a PCR record-based macroelimination project for systematic recall of HCV-RNA-positive persons in Austria.
Micro-elimination projects targeted to specific hepatitis C virus (HCV) risk populations have been successful. Systematic identification of persons with HCV viremia, regardless of risk group, based on already available laboratory records may represent an effective macroelimination approach to achieve global HCV elimination. ⋯ This ELIMINATE project based on systematic assessment of HCV-RNA PCR-records, identified 6006 persons with potential persisting HCV viremia. Invalid contact data and missed visits for treatment evaluation were the main barriers towards HCV elimination within this project. Importantly, many subjects with HCV viremia lost to follow-up were successfully linked to care and started antiviral treatment.

Practice GuidelineSame-day discharge after percutaneous coronary procedures-Consensus statement of the working group of interventional cardiology (AGIK) of the Austrian Society of Cardiology.
Percutaneous coronary intervention is a well-established revascularization strategy for patients with coronary artery disease. Recent technical advances such as radial access, third generation drug-eluting stents and highly effective antiplatelet therapy have substantially improved the safety profile of coronary procedures. Despite several practice guidelines and a clear patient preference of early hospital discharge, the percentage of coronary procedures performed in an outpatient setting in Austria remains low, mostly due to safety concerns. ⋯ Based on the data analysis this consensus document provides detailed practice guidelines for the safe operation of daycare cathlab programs in Austria.

Association of physical activity with MAFLD/MASLD and LF among adults in NHANES, 2017-2020.
To investigate the correlations between physical activity (PA) and metabolic associated fatty liver disease (MAFLD) or metabolic dysfunction-associated steatotic liver disease (MASLD) within a substantial population-based survey, and to examine the association between PA and liver fibrosis (LF). ⋯ Participation in active LTPA is associated with a reduced likelihood of MAFLD/MASLD and LF, while neither OPA nor TPA can replace these effects of LTPA.
